Federal Programs


Georgetown Independent School District participates in federally-funded programs designed to support Bilingual, English as a Second Language, and Migrant Education.

These programs provide support for students whose native language is not English, or who have limited English proficiency, or who face educational disruptions as a result of repeated moves.

Other federal programs include:

  • Title I, Part A : Improving Basic Programs
  • Title I, Part D, Subpart 2: Prevention & Intervention Programs for Children and Youth who are Neglected, Delinquent, or At-Risk
  • Title II, Part A: Teacher and Principal Recruiting Program
  • Title II, Part D: Enhancing Education through Technology
  • Title III, Part A: LEP and Immigrant Program
  • Title IV, Part A: Safe and Drug Free Schools and Communities Program
  • Title V, Part A: Innovative Programs
  • State Compensatory Education Program
  • McKinney-Vento - Texas Homeless Education Assistance Program
  • Pre-Kindergarten Grant Program
